Santa Cruz Vegetarian Stops

Santa Cruz is one of the best food stops. It has strong vegetarian and vegan options.

Saturn Cafe

This restaurant is fully vegetarian friendly. It serves vegan burgers, breakfast, and shakes.

The food is casual and comforting.It is a popular stop for road trippers.

Dharma’s Restaurant

This restaurant focuses on healthy vegetarian food.It uses organic and fresh ingredients.

You can find bowls, salads, and smoothies. It is good for light meals.

Monterey Vegetarian Stops

Monterey has scenic dining and better variety. It is a good evening stop.

El Cantaro Vegan Taqueria

This is a fully vegan Mexican restaurant.It serves tacos, burritos, and bowls.

The food is flavorful and filling. It is popular among vegan travelers.

Local Cafes with Vegetarian Options

Monterey also has many small cafes. They serve vegetarian-friendly sandwiches and salads.

Seafood restaurants also offer vegetarian sides. You can customize many meals easily.

Big Sur Vegetarian Stops

Big Sur offers limited but scenic dining. Food comes with ocean views.

Nepenthe

This cliffside restaurant offers vegetarian options.It is known for its ocean views.

Meals are simple but memorable. The location is the main attraction.

Cafe Kevah

This open-air cafe sits near Nepenthe. It serves light vegetarian-friendly meals.

The seating faces the ocean. It is perfect for relaxed dining.

Big Sur Bakery

This bakery serves fresh vegetarian food. It includes pizzas, bread, and pastries.

The ingredients are locally sourced. It is a cozy stop.

Ripplewood Restaurant

This is a simple roadside restaurant.It offers vegetarian breakfast and comfort food.

It works well for quick stops. Service is fast and simple.
